آموزش کلاس Scale در PyGTK

3 سال پیش
آموزش کلاس Scale در PyGTK
امتیاز دهید post

آموزش کلاس Scale در PyGTK

در این درس از مجموعه آموزش برنامه نویسی سایت سورس باران، به آموزش کلاس Scale در PyGTK خواهیم پرداخت.

پیشنهاد ویژه : پکیج آموزش پایتون

این کلاس به عنوان یک کلاس پایه انتزاعی برای ابزارک های HScale و VScale عمل می کند. این ابزارک ها به عنوان یک کنترل کننده لغزنده عمل می کنند و مقدار عددی را انتخاب می کنند.

روش های زیر از این کلاس انتزاعی توسط کلاس HScale و کلاس VScale پیاده سازی می شود –

  • ()set_digits  – این تعداد رقم اعشار را برای نمایش مقدار لحظه ای ویجت مورد استفاده قرار می دهد.
  • ()set_draw_value  – روی True تنظیم کنید، مقدار فعلی در کنار نوار لغزنده نمایش داده می شود.
  • ()set_value_pos – این موقعیتی است که مقادیر در آن ترسیم می شوند. این می تواند gtk.POS_LEFT ، gtk.POS_RIGHT ، gtk.POS_TOP یا gtk.POS_BOTTOM باشد.

یک شیء از کلاس gtk.HScale یک نوار لغزنده افقی ارائه می دهد، در حالی که یک شی از کلاس gtk.VScale یک نوار لغزنده عمودی را ارائه می دهد. هر دو کلاس دارای سازه های یکسان هستند –

 

شیء adjustment شامل بسیاری از ویژگی ها است که دسترسی به مقدار و محدوده را فراهم می کند.

 

منبع.

 

لیست جلسات قبل آموزش PyGTK

  1. آموزش PyGTK
  2. معرفی PyGTK
  3. آموزش محیط  PyGTK
  4. آموزش Hello World در  PyGTK
  5. آموزش کلاس های مهم در  PyGTK
  6. آموزش کلاس پنجره در PyGTK
  7. آموزش کلاس دکمه در PyGTK
  8. آموزش کلاس لیبل در PyGTK
  9. آموزش کلاس ورود در PyGTK
  10. آموزش مدیریت سیگنال در PyGTK
  11. آموزش مدیریت رویداد در PyGTK
  12. آموزش کانتینر در PyGTK
  13. آموزش کلاس جعبه در PyGTK
  14. آموزش کلاس ButtonBox در PyGTK
  15. آموزش کلاس تراز در PyGTK
  16. آموزش کلاس EventBox در PyGTK
  17. آموزش کلاس Layout در PyGTK
  18. آموزش کلاس ComboBox در PyGTK
  19. آموزش کلاس ToggleButton در PyGTK
  20. آموزش کلاس CheckButton در PyGTK
  21. آموزش کلاس RadioButton در PyGTK
  22. آموزش MenuBar ،Menu و MenuItem در PyGTK
  23. آموزش کلاس نوار ابزار در PyGTK
  24. آموزش کلاس Adjustment در PyGTK
  25. موزش کلاس Range در PyGTK
امتیاز دهید post
0
برچسب ها :
نویسنده مطلب saber

دیدگاه شما

بدون دیدگاه